For job seekers in Steele City, an employment agency offers a direct line to opportunities you might not find on your own. Many local manufacturers, agricultural operations, and businesses in nearby cities like Fairbury or Hebron work with agencies to fill positions quietly, seeking reliable candidates without a public posting. By partnering with an agency, you gain an advocate who understands your skills, your work ethic valued in our community, and your career goals. They can connect you with temporary, temp-to-hire, or direct placement roles, providing a flexible pathway to stable employment. This is especially valuable if you're looking to transition into a new industry or gain experience with a reputable local company.
For Steele City area employers, from family farms to main street businesses, employment agencies solve critical staffing pains. Finding qualified, dependable workers for seasonal peaks, specialized projects, or permanent roles can drain valuable time and resources. A local-focused agency pre-screens candidates, checks references, and ensures a good cultural fit for your Nebraska work environment. They handle the administrative burden of payroll and taxes for temporary staff, allowing you to manage workflow fluctuations common in our agricultural and industrial sectors without long-term commitment. It’s a smart way to "try before you buy" an employee, ensuring they are the right match for your team's needs.
To maximize the value of an employment agency, be proactive. As a job seeker, treat your meeting with a recruiter like a serious interview. Be clear about your transportation capabilities, as some roles may be in neighboring towns. For employers, communicate openly about your company culture and the specific hard and soft skills needed—reliability and a strong work ethic are often prized as much as technical skills here. Building a relationship with a reputable agency means they become an extension of your HR department, deeply invested in the success of both candidate and company.
